What are entry level tattoo friendly jobs?

Entry level tattoo friendly jobs are positions that do not require prior experience and welcome or accept visible tattoos in the workplace. These roles are often found in creative industries, hospitality, retail, and certain service sectors where self-expression is valued. Common examples include baristas, retail associates, artists, servers, and positions in tattoo parlors. Employers in these fields typically have more relaxed appearance policies, making them ideal for individuals with visible tattoos. It's always a good idea to review a company's dress code or ask about their tattoo policy during the interview process.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level tattoo artist?

To thrive as an Entry Level Tattoo Artist, you need foundational drawing skills, knowledge of sanitation practices, and often a state-specific tattooing license or completion of an apprenticeship. Familiarity with tattoo machines, sterilization equipment, and basic design software is typically required. Strong communication, attention to detail, and adaptability help build client trust and support artistic growth. These skills and qualities ensure safe, high-quality work and a positive reputation in a competitive industry.

What are some common challenges entry-level employees might face in a tattoo-friendly workplace?

Entry-level employees in tattoo-friendly workplaces may find it easier to express their individuality, but they can still encounter challenges such as adapting to professional expectations and navigating diverse clients' attitudes toward visible tattoos. While the environment is more accepting, maintaining professionalism and excellent customer service is crucial, as perceptions of tattoos can still vary among clients and team members. Additionally, employees must balance self-expression with workplace policies regarding tattoo content and visibility, especially in client-facing roles.

How do I get into entry level tattoo friendly with no experience?

Entry level tattoo friendly positions often involve assisting experienced tattoo artists, gaining exposure to the studio environment, and developing basic skills such as hygiene, stencil application, and equipment handling. Building a portfolio of your artwork and demonstrating a strong work ethic can improve your chances, even without prior tattooing experience.
